The Myocardium and Conduction System Beyond the chambers lies the myocardium, the thick muscular wall of the heart responsible for its contractile force. An electrocardiogram (ECG or EKG) measures the electrical activity of the heart, producing a tracing that reveals the heart rate and rhythm.

Key medical terms in this context include the sinoatrial (SA) node, often called the natural pacemaker, and the atrioventricular (AV) node, which acts as a relay station to delay the signal slightly before it reaches the ventricles.

Valves ensure unidirectional flow, with the tricuspid and mitral valves controlling inflow between the atria and ventricles, while the pulmonary and aortic valves regulate outflow from the ventricles.
